drm/amd/display: Use kernel alloc/free
Abstractions are frowned upon.
cocci script:
virtual context
virtual patch
virtual org
virtual report
@@
expression ptr;
@@
- dm_alloc(ptr)
+ kzalloc(ptr, GFP_KERNEL)
@@
expression ptr, size;
@@
- dm_realloc(ptr, size)
+ krealloc(ptr, size, GFP_KERNEL)
@@
expression ptr;
@@
- dm_free(ptr)
+ kfree(ptr)
v2: use GFP_KERNEL, not GFP_ATOMIC. add cocci script
